I would like some help reviving Samsung 245b Plus.
Model: 245BPLUS
Model Code: LS24HUBCBL/EDC
Type No: HU24BS
The Symptoms:
Monitor appears to be on(Blue Light on solid)
No signal to screen, no menu
Worked for a few days by turning it off for 30 seconds then on again but it eventually gave up
So far following your guide I have taken apart the monitor and removed the power board. Examined the board and documented the capacitors i see there. Please point out if I've missed any.
The Images
Sorry for the external link but my pics were too big and I dont have photo shop installed on my laptop to downsize the pics.
- Caps
A: 10 uF 50v
B: 47 uF 50v
C: 1000 uF 35v *
D: 1000 uF 35v *
E: 1000 uF 10v
F: 470 uF 35v
G: 2200 uF 10v
H: 2.2 uF 50v
I: 47 uF 50v #
J: 22 uF 50v
K: 10 uF 50v
L: 47 uF 50v #
M: 82 uF 450v ?
So it seems i need:
1* 2.2 uF 50v
2* 10 uF 50v
1* 22 uF 50v
3* 47 uF 50v
1* 470 uF 35v
1* 1000 uF 10v
2* 1000 uF 35v
1* 2200 uF 10v
1* 82 uF 450v ??
To my untrained eye I don't see any sign of damage on the capacitors.
I have read this Samsung Syncmaster 245B thread
Should I bother changing the big 450v 82uF cap? I have not experienced flickering. If yes how would i go about discharging it?
I have compared the caps i need to the kit here and they do not match. Why do the kit contents not list voltage of the cap?
